The Value of a Will in Estate Planning
While you may have a general concept of what you want performed with your possessions, a will is important to assure your wishes are lawfully identified. It acts as a clear, written paper that details how you desire your residential or commercial property dispersed after your passing. Without a will, your estate may fall under intestacy laws, which commonly does not align with your wishes.
Creating a will certainly permits you to choose recipients, specify guardians for your kids, and also assign an executor to handle your estate. This not only supplies comfort however also decreases potential dispute amongst household participants.
Additionally, a will can streamline the probate procedure, making it simpler and quicker for your liked ones to settle your affairs. Basically, a well-crafted will is a crucial part of your estate plan, making certain that your heritage is preserved according to your particular dreams. Limited Power of Attorney
While you might understand the general principle of a Power of Lawyer, a Limited Power of Attorney (LPOA) serves a certain objective that can be tremendously useful in specific scenarios. An LPOA allows you to give a person authority to act upon your part for a limited time or for particular jobs, like managing monetary transactions or dealing with realty matters. This kind of arrangement serves if you're traveling, undertaking medical treatment, or merely need assistance with certain affairs. It's crucial you can look here to choose someone you depend on, as they'll have the power to choose in your stead. By defining the extent of authority, an LPOA warranties your interests are shielded without relinquishing full control.

The Function of Administrators and Trustees in Your Estate Strategy
Recognizing the functions of trustees and executors is essential for reliable estate planning, as these individuals are in charge of carrying out your wishes after you're gone. The administrator manages your estate, guaranteeing that your financial debts are paid and your possessions are dispersed according to your will. Picking a person trustworthy and arranged is important; they'll deal with the legal and monetary intricacies entailed.
On the other hand, a trustee oversees any trust funds you have actually established. He or she is in charge of managing the count on assets and adhering to the terms you have actually developed. If you want to offer minors or secure properties from lenders, a trustee is substantial.
Both functions call for a clear understanding of your purposes, so selecting wisely will aid assure your tradition is recognized. Review your options with potential executors and trustees, ensuring they're able and prepared to tackle these important obligations.

Can I Change My Will After It's Been Created?
Yes, you can alter your will certainly after it's been developed. You'll require to adhere to the lawful procedure, typically including preparing a new will or creating a codicil. Just ensure it's effectively experienced to stay valid.
What Happens if I Pass Away Without a Will?
If you die without a will, state laws determine exactly how your possessions get dispersed. You will not have control over your heritage, and it can find out result in conflicts among family members or unexpected recipients.
Exactly how Often Should I Evaluation My Estate Strategy?
You must review your estate strategy every few years or whenever considerable life modifications happen, like marriage, divorce, or the birth of a youngster. Normal updates guarantee your wishes are existing and accurately mirrored.
Are Verbal Wills Legally Binding?
Spoken wills aren't usually legitimately binding. A lot of jurisdictions call for written documents to ensure your wishes are recognized. It's best to formalize your estate plan with a legitimately recognized will certainly to avoid prospective disputes.
Can a Power of Lawyer Be Withdrawed?
Yes, you can revoke a power of attorney anytime, as long as you're mentally competent. Simply make sure to notify the agent and any kind of relevant organizations in writing to assure your wishes are clear.
